Technique is what works.
Good technique is what works often.

What is the technique a pot-maker needs? Whatever art allows him to make pots. What is the technique a judo player needs? Whatever technique allows him to score Ippon.

Who cares if the pot-maker sings and dances while making his pots? That might make the sight more enjoyable, but it has nothing to do with his pot-making technique.

Problem is: traditional guys think there are only as much techniques in Judo as there are entries in the GO-KYO. Well here is one thought that should make you feel awesome, Judo mystics: There are as many Judo techniques as there are stars in the universe. The GO_KYO is just a list of names really. If a technique doesn't fit one category, it doesn't make it less 'technical'.
